In 1897, Shirley M Calvin entered the world in Missouri, born to William J Calvin and Elfrida Calvin. In 1900, Shirley M Calvin resided in Richland Township, Cowley, Kansas. In 1910, Shirley M Calvin resided in Richland, Cowley, Kansas. Shirley M Calvin married Clair Butler Scroggy, and had children including Doris Nadine Scroggy, Dorothy J Scroggy. Shirley M Calvin passed away in 1969 in Minneapolis, Kansas.
